Summary: Polyvinyl alcohol (PVA) is a non-toxic biosynthetic polymer with hydrophilic properties. In this study, high-performance composite materials were obtained by cross-linking PVA with aldehyde-functionalized polysulfone (mPSF) precursor and incorporating modified multi-walled carbon nanotubes (mMWCNTs) with hydrophilic groups. The properties of the composites were compared with those based on PVA and the same fillers, and it was found that the polymeric matrix has an influence on the composite properties. The composites prepared in this way have potential applications in water purification or blood-filtration materials.

Summary: In this study, hydrophilic poly (ethylene-co-vinyl alcohol) (EVOH) and hydrophobic polysulfone (PSF) were blended together using polyethylene glycol (PEG) as a hydrophilic additive and compatibilizer, which resulted in ultrafiltration (UF) membranes with high porosity and antifouling properties. The optimal PEG content for blending with PSF/EVOH was found to be 20 wt%. The blended membranes exhibited improved miscibility, pure water permeance, and antifouling properties, making them suitable for wastewater treatment.

Summary: The study focuses on the fabrication and evaluation of blended membranes composed of polysulfone and cellulose triacetate for CO2/CH4 separation. The results show that the dense, defect-free membranes exhibit promising performance in terms of CO2 selectivity and permeability, with a significant improvement over the pristine membranes. Moreover, the blended membranes also demonstrate a higher tensile strength compared to the pure cellulose triacetate membrane.

Summary: In this study, polysulfone (PSF), sulfonated polysulfone (SPSF), and sulfonated polysulfone/dextran (SPSF/GLU) membranes were successfully fabricated for LDL adsorption. The SPSF/GLU membrane exhibited high resistance to protein adsorption and a similar adsorption capacity to PSF. The SPSF membrane showed excellent selective affinity for LDL in single and binary protein solutions, suggesting potential applications in LDL removal.
